Athletic Program Statistics for the University of Rochester Women's Tennis Sports Program

Detailed Breakdown University of Rochester NCAA Division III (with football)
Average Number of Athletes - 11
Total Number of Athletes 8 2,300
Average Operating Expenses Per Player $4,003 $1,050
Average Operating Expenses Per Team $32,025 $11,710
Total Full Time Head Coaches 0 5
Total Part Time Head Coaches 0 77
Total Full Time Assistant Coaches 0 1
Total Part Time Assistant Coaches 2 79
Average Total Revenue $45,811 $34,920
Average Total Expenses $62,294 $34,419
